HONG KONG, Nov. 11, 2021 /PRNewswire/ — The Florentine luxury watchmaker celebrates Super-Luminova™, one of Panerai’s iconic materials, by launching a one-of-a-kind Light Painting Competition – Luminate Your Time Challenge at Canton Road Flagship Boutique from 3rd to 21st November 2021. For the first time in the luxury watch industry an interactive event in light painting will run for 19 consecutive days, an unforgettable and magical experience, debuting exclusively worldwide.

Light painting is created by photographing with long exposure of up to a minute in a dark environment. Customers can “paint” with light in the air according to their movement and creativity, without involving any touch ups.

Founded in Florence in 1860 as a workshop, shop and subsequently school of watch-making, for many decades Panerai supplied the Italian Navy and its specialist diving corps in particular with precision instruments.

The designs developed by Panerai in that time, including the Luminor and Radiomir, were covered by the Military Secrets Act for many years and were launched on the international market only after the brand was acquired by the Richemont Group in 1997.

Today Panerai develops and crafts its movements and watches at its Neuchâtel manufacture. The latter are a seamless melding of Italian design flair and history with Swiss horological expertise. Panerai watches are sold across the world through an exclusive network of distributors and Panerai boutiques.
